Puppet conservation is vital in preserving the history and artistry of puppet shows, as well as maintaining the cultural heritage they represent.

Preserving historical artifacts, such as puppets and puppet theaters, requires careful attention to detail and specialized knowledge. Conservationists work tirelessly to repair, restore, and protect these fragile objects, ensuring that they remain intact for years to come.

One of the challenges in puppet conservation is the delicate nature of the materials used to create these artifacts. Puppets are often made from a variety of materials, such as wood, fabric, and clay, all of which can degrade over time if not properly cared for. Conservationists must use specialized techniques to clean, repair, and stabilize these materials without causing further damage.

Another challenge in puppet conservation is the limited funding and resources available for this specialized field. Many puppet theaters and collections struggle to find the support they need to properly care for their artifacts, leading to neglect and deterioration over time.
